YANKEE DOODLE DANDY

Originator: Smith, D.R., 2002
Colour: Deep cerise pink to antique pink

Form: Semi-Double
Bloom Time: Late Mid-Season

Side Buds: Yes
Height: Medium - above 30 inches
Fragrance: None
Peony Group: Itoh

Distinction: Self supporting, best landscaper, longevity of bloom

Description: Outstanding for a stunning flower display and sheer amount of bloom. Yankee Doodle Dandy is routinely blanketed with an incredible amount of flowers. Cream undertones that become more apparent as pigments bleach in the sun give flowers depth and dimension and provide plants with visual interest as the flower appears to have layers of deep cerise pink intermixed with antique pinks towards terminal flower stages. Strong, rigid stems hold the flower upright under all conditions, as expected of an intersectional peony, and attractive, deep green Itoh type foliage results in a good looking plant all season long. Many side buds extend the blooming period.
